    Cyprinodontiformes are also known as toothcarps, they are dubbed to be survival artists because most of them are adaptable to new environment, as a matter of fact the common gambusia affinis and/or poecilia reticulata ( wild guppy ), locally known as "isda sa sapa" or "rainbow" are introduced almost worldwide because of such adaptability. Killifishes have also earned such reputation since they can exist even on temporary bodies of water or pools in some parts of africa, some of them are annual killies since they will die out when the dry season comes, their eggs which are burried in mud, will hatch in the onset of the next rainy season. Breeding killies aren't hard, they can be bred in an aquarium with mud and once the the eggs are deposited and fertilized, you can then remove the breeding pair and carefully empty the tankwater without disturbing the mud, let the mud dry and then add water, the water will trigger the eggs to hatch.


    Toothcarps


    Live-bearing toothcarps
    guppy, molly, platy, swordtail, dwarf livebearer and etc.


    WILD GUPPY - An introduced species in the philippines. A few other related species were also used to control mosquito larvae.


    FANCY GUPY - Paborito ni smalltime guppy.


    ENDLER'S GUPPY - There are a few varieties of endler's, and most of them are costly.


    RED "MICKEY MOUSE" PLATY - Sometimes mislabelled as ballon mollies in manalili, but displays a huge difference.




    Egg-laying toothcarps
    Killifish, nothobranch, panchax, pearlfish, american flagfish and etc.


    BLUE PANCHAX KILLIFISH - A native philippine species. hopefully we will encounter this in one of our future trekkings.


    LYRETAIL KILLIFISH - One of the longer living Killies with a lifespan of 3 years.


    RACHOW'S NOTHOBRANCH - A brilliantly colored notho, which is best kept in a community tank of small peaceful inhabitants.


    AMERICAN FLAGFISH - This is a very nice species, i use to see these sold at Piper's, but i have not been able to due to lack of space.




    NOTE:

    Rainbowfishes are not toothcarps, they belong to a family of their own. Rainbowfishes have a split fin design on their dorsal fin which distinguished them from toothcarps

    Here are some rainbow species:

    BOESEMAN'S RAINBOWFISH - One of the most popular rainbowfish.


    WESTERN RAINBOWFISH - The species name of this rainbowfish is australis and not trifaciata.


    BANDED RAINBOWFISH - This is the real trifaciata species. I have not been able to see these in cebu yet.
